What OnlyFans Verifies
OnlyFans checks two things before you can be verified: that you’re 18 or over, and that you have the right to be paid.
Accepted documents
A range of photo IDs are accepted, as long as they clearly display your full legal name, a clear photo, and date of birth.
IDs that can be used include:
- Passport
- National identity card
- Driver’s licence
- Government-issued ID card

Step 3: Take your selfie with ID
Once you upload your ID, you’ll need to take a selfie holding it next to your face. This confirms the ID actually belongs to you, so make sure your face is fully visible with no accessories or hair covering it.
Take the photo somewhere well-lit, and hold the ID at arm’s length so your face and the text on the ID stay in focus simultaneously.
Step 4: Tax documentation
UK OnlyFans creators earning more than £1,000 gross per tax year must register as self-employed with HMRC. US-based creators need to complete a W-9 form once their identity is verified. These official forms will require your legal name, address, and taxpayer ID number.
Step 5: Wait for approval
Once you’ve submitted everything, OnlyFans will send you an email once a decision has been made. Creators usually hear back within 24–72 hours, though it can take longer during busier periods.

Sometimes even when you’ve followed the steps correctly, verification can still get rejected. If this happens, here are some of the most common reasons why and how to fix each one.
Blurry ID photo
This can be caused by poor lighting or dirt on the camera lens. Take the photo somewhere bright, tap the screen to lock focus on the ID first, and give the lens a quick wipe to make sure it’s free from any dust.
Glare over your ID
If you’ve used a flash, this can obscure your details and trigger an automatic rejection. Turn your flash off and tilt the ID slightly so any light source reflects away from the camera rather than into it.
Name mismatch with your bank details
OnlyFans verification issues can occur if the name on your ID and payout account do not match. Update your payment details to match your ID exactly before resubmitting.
VPN switched on
Verification providers flag a mismatch between your IP address and your stated location as a fraud risk. Turn off your VPN before you start the process, and you can switch it back on once you’re verified.
Expired ID
An expired document will always be rejected, so double-check the date before you submit and use a current form of ID.
Partial ID in frame
All four corners of your ID need to be visible in the shot. Move the camera back slightly or use a wider angle so nothing gets cropped out.
Incorrect file type or size
Photos need to be uploaded as a JPG or PNG under the platform’s file size limit. If your upload keeps failing, check the format before assuming it’s a documentation issue.
